The postcode LU3 3SU is located in Luton It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. LU3 3SU is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

LU3 3SU is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 2.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of LU3 3SU as Multicultural metropolitans > Rented family living > Social renting young families.

The closest road name to LU3 3SU is Burnt Close which is centered 24 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Woodlands Secondary School and is 103 m away. The closest railway station is Leagrave Rail Station, 1.28 km away.

The closest primary school to LU3 3SU (for ages 11 and under) is Waulud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on October 11,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Woodlands Secondary School. The last OFSTED inspection on November 3, 2016 rated this school as Outstanding

The local pub for residents of LU3 3SU is Barton Bowls Club and is 5.67 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on November 18,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Sizzling Dutch Pot Ltd and is 5.7 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as AwaitingInspection .

Residents reported an average download speed of 129.3 Mbps and an average upload speed of 16.2 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.8 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for LU3 3SU is covered by the Bedfordshire police force association and Luton is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
